Lines Matching defs:divide
9 // This file defines the class that knows how to divide SCEV's.
55 void SCEVDivision::divide(ScalarEvolution &SE, const SCEV *Numerator,
88 divide(SE, *Quotient, Op, &Q, &R);
137 divide(SE, Numerator->getStart(), Denominator, &StartQ, &StartR);
138 divide(SE, Numerator->getStepRecurrence(SE), Denominator, &StepQ, &StepR);
156 divide(SE, Op, Denominator, &Q, &R);
193 divide(SE, Op, Denominator, &Q, &R);
237 divide(SE, Diff, Denominator, &Q, &R);
249 // We generally do not know how to divide Expr by Denominator. We initialize
250 // the division to a "cannot divide" state to simplify the rest of the code.